WebAug 24, 2024 · Poner is a Spanish irregular verb because it requires a stem change for some conjugations. Its main verb stem is pon-. This verb stem is the result of subtracting the infinitive ending '-er'... WebThe irregular -go ending of the yo form follows to keep the list of -go verbs together. A verb that ends in -go in the yo form will keep the g when you drop the -o to form usted, ustedes, and the negative tú command forms. In addition, they generally have irregular affirmative tú command forms.
